Advanced Microwave Engineering
is a specialized field that deals with the design, development, and application of microwave systems. This field is crucial in various industries such as telecommunications, aerospace, and medical devices.Global Certificate in Advanced Microwave Engineering
is designed for professionals and students who want to acquire knowledge in this specialized field. The program covers topics such as microwave theory, antenna design, and millimeter wave engineering.Some of the key areas of focus include:
Microwave circuit design and simulation
Antenna design and optimization
Millimeter wave propagation and characterization
Microwave system integration and testing
By completing this program, learners will gain a comprehensive understanding of advanced microwave engineering principles and be able to apply them in real-world scenarios.
